I am diabetic and control it with diet alone. Part of my daily routine is a large salad before dinner. When I was on Carnival back in May I had to ask for a Caesar salad without the dressing ( I bring my own low fat/sugar) and was given 4 leaves of green. Is there a way to request each night at dinner in the MDR for a full bowl or plate of mixed greens? We will be on the Anthem next month and noticed requests need to be before 30 days which I missed

I am not a diabetic but travel with people who have dietary needs. Plus I have done many RCI cruises and witnessed what other people do.

 

IME, making a special request like having a bowl full of leaf salad shouldn't be a problem and you can simply ask the waiter. If you want to be a little pro-active, letting the restaurant manager know ahead of time helps. Sometimes, with the best intentions you don't get served what you requested. Politely letting the waiter know or having a quiet word with the restaurant manager should resolve the problem, if not on that occasion then at least for subsequent nights.

 

Finally, I have found that being on the same table with same server helps avoid problems.

We don't have traditional dining but hope to eat in the same section each night. Is it one manager for both types of dining rooms?

There is a Restaurant Operations Manager that is the head of all dining, but each deck has it's own supervisor, and MTD has different hosts than traditional.
